What does Amgen do?

Amgen Inc. is a global biotechnology company focused on the development and production of pharmaceuticals. It was founded in 1980 by William K. Bowes Jr. and George B. Rathmann in Thousand Oaks, California/USA. The founders had the vision to create new treatment options for serious diseases such as cancer, autoimmune diseases, and osteoporosis. Amgen faced difficulties in its early days due to limited financial resources and setbacks in research. However, the company succeeded in developing the first recombinant therapeutic protein drug, Erythropoietin (EPO), and bringing it to the market. Today, Amgen has become one of the largest biotechnology companies in the world with over 24,000 employees worldwide. The company is known for its research and development work in oncology, kidney diseases, blood disorders, inflammation, and bone diseases. Amgen's business model involves investing in research and development to develop new drugs and commercialize them in global markets. The company follows a "biological platform" strategy, focusing on biotechnology products based on proteins and antibodies. Amgen has several product lines, including Biologics, Biosimilars, and Small Molecules. Biologics are protein-based drugs manufactured using living cells. Biosimilars are products that have similar structures to existing biologics. Small Molecules are chemically manufactured drugs. Some of Amgen's most well-known products include Epogen and Aranesp (both Erythropoietin-releasing hormones), Neulasta and Neupogen (both granulocyte colony-stimulating factors), Enbrel (a TNF inhibitor for the treatment of rheumatoid arthritis), Prolia and Xgeva (both Denosumab inhibitors for the treatment of osteoporosis), and Blincyto (a bispecific antibody against cancer). Amgen is also involved in cancer immunotherapy and has a range of medications in its portfolio, including a CAR-T immunotherapy used for certain forms of acute lymphoblastic leukemia (ALL). In addition, Amgen specializes in the development of biosimilars. In 2017, the company introduced six biosimilars to the market, including copies of Enbrel and Humira for the treatment of rheumatoid arthritis. Biosimilars have the potential to reduce the costs of patient treatment as they are typically cheaper than the original products. Decoding Amgen's Return on Equity (ROE)

Amgen's Return on Equity (ROE) is a fundamental metric evaluating the company's profitability relative to its equity. Calculated by dividing net income by shareholder's equity, ROE illustrates how effectively the company is generating profits from shareholders’ investments. A higher ROE represents enhanced efficiency and profitability.

Stock savings plans offer an attractive way for investors to build wealth over the long term. One of the main advantages is the so-called cost-average effect: by regularly investing a fixed amount in stocks or stock funds, you automatically buy more shares when prices are low, and fewer when they are high. This can lead to a more favorable average price per share over time. In addition, stock savings plans allow small investors access to expensive stocks, as they can participate with small amounts. Regular investment also promotes a disciplined investment strategy and helps to avoid emotional decisions, such as impulsive buying or selling. Furthermore, investors benefit from the potential appreciation of the stocks as well as from dividend distributions, which can be reinvested, enhancing the compounding effect and thus the growth of the invested capital.
